About International Culinary Arts and Sciences Institute
International Culinary Arts and Sciences Institute is a small institution located in Chesterland, Ohio, primarily awarding the certificate. It enrolls roughly 33 undergraduate students in a rural setting. The most popular fields of study include Personal services.
